Запитання з тегом «css-selectors»

Селектори - це шаблони, які відповідають елементам дерева дерева. У правилі CSS вони використовуються для визначення стилів для елементів, що відповідають шаблону.

3
Css псевдокласи введення: не (відключено) не: [type = “submit”]: фокус
Я хочу застосувати деякий css для елементів вводу, і я хочу це зробити лише для входів, які не вимкнені і не надсилають тип, нижче css не працює, можливо, якщо хтось може мені пояснити, як це потрібно додати. input:not(disabled)not:[type="submit"]:focus{ box-shadow:0 0 2px 0 #0066FF; -webkit-box-shadow:0 0 4px 0 #66A3FF; }

3
Як виключити назву конкретного класу в селекторі CSS?
Я намагаюся застосувати фоновий колір, коли миша користувача наводить елемент, ім'я якого класу "reMode_hover". Але я не хочу змінювати колір, якщо елемент також є"reMode_selected" Примітка. Я можу використовувати лише CSS не javascript, оскільки я працюю в якомусь обмеженому середовищі. Для уточнення, моя мета - забарвити перший елемент на наведення курсору, …
137 html  css  css-selectors 

7
Застосовуйте стиль лише до першого тегу td
Чи є спосіб застосувати стиль класу лише до одного рівня тегів td? <style>.MyClass td {border: solid 1px red;}</style> <table class="MyClass"> <tr> <td> THIS SHOULD HAVE RED BORDERS </td> <td> THIS SHOULD HAVE RED BORDERS <table><tr><td>THIS SHOULD NOT HAVE ANY</td></tr></table> </td> </tr> </table>
136 css  css-selectors 

2
Виберіть другий останній елемент css
Я вже знаю про: останню дитину. Але чи є спосіб вибрати div: <div id="container"> <div>a</div> <div>b</div> <div>SELECT THIS</div> <!-- THIS --> <div>c</div> </div> ПРИМІТКА: без jQuery, лише з CSS
135 html  css  css-selectors 

2
: після vs. :: після
Чи є якась функціональна різниця між CSS 2.1 :afterта псевдоселекторами CSS 3 ::after(крім того, що їх ::afterне підтримують у старих браузерах)? Чи є якісь практичні причини використовувати новішу специфікацію?

4
CSS Псевдокласи з вбудованими стилями
На цей питання є відповіді на Stack Overflow на російському : Як записати: навести вказівник style = ''? Чи можливо мати псевдокласи, використовуючи стилі вбудованого? Приклад: <a href="http://www.google.com" style="hover:text-decoration:none;">Google</a> Я знаю, що вищевказаний HTML не працюватиме, але чи є щось подібне? PS Я знаю, що я повинен використовувати зовнішній аркуш …

5
Чи можливо вибрати останні n елементів із nth-дочіркою?
Використовуючи стандартний список, я намагаюся вибрати два останні списки. У мене різні перестановки, An+Bале останні 2, здається, не вибирають останні: li:nth-child(n+2) {} /* selects from the second onwards */ li:nth-child(n-2) {} /* selects everything */ li:nth-child(-n+2) {} /* selects first two only */ li:nth-child(-n-2) {} /* selects nothing */ Мені …
130 css  css-selectors 


2
Sass та комбінований добірчик дітей
Я щойно виявив Сасса, і мене так схвилював. На своєму веб-сайті я реалізую деревоподібне навігаційне меню, створене за допомогою дочірнього комбінатора ( E > F). Чи є спосіб переписати цей код більш простим (або кращим) синтаксисом у Sass? #foo > ul > li > ul > li > a { …
126 css  css-selectors  sass 

4
Визначення того, чи jQuery не знайшов жодного елемента
Я використовую селектори jQuery, особливо селектор id: $("#elementId")... Як слід визначити, знайшов елемент jQuery чи ні? Навіть якщо елемента із вказаним ідентифікатором не існує, наступне твердження дайте мені:[object Object] alert($("#idThatDoesnotexist"));

7
Як підраховуються бали за специфікою CSS
Досліджуючи специфіку, я натрапив на цей блог - http://www.htmldog.com/guides/cssadvanced/specificity/ У ньому зазначається, що специфіка є системою бальних оцінок для CSS. Це говорить нам, що елементи вартують 1 бал, класи - 10 балів, а ідентифікатори - 100 балів. Крім того, слід сказати, що ці бали підсумовані, і загальна сума - це …

3
Як використовувати querySelectorAll лише для елементів, які мають певний набір атрибутів?
Я намагаюся використовувати document.querySelectorAllдля всіх прапорців, у яких встановлений valueатрибут. На сторінці є інші прапорці, які не valueвстановлені, і значення для кожного прапорця різне. Ідентифікатори та назви, однак, не унікальні. Приклад: <input type="checkbox" id="c2" name="c2" value="DE039230952"/> Як встановити лише ті прапорці, у яких встановлені значення?

3
Чим відрізняється: перша дитина від: перша дитина?
Я не можу сказати різницю між element:first-childтаelement:first-of-type Наприклад, скажіть, у вас був дів div:first-child → Усі <div>елементи, які є першою дитиною свого батька. div:first-of-type → Усі <div>елементи, які є першим <div>елементом їхнього батьківського. Це здається точно такою ж справою, але вони працюють по-різному. Може хтось пояснить, будь ласка?
124 css  css-selectors 

10
Використання querySelectorAll для отримання прямих дітей
Я вмію це робити: <div id="myDiv"> <div class="foo"></div> </div> myDiv = getElementById("myDiv"); myDiv.querySelectorAll("#myDiv > .foo"); Тобто я можу успішно отримати всіх прямих дітей myDivелемента, які мають клас .foo. Проблема полягає в тому, що мене турбує те, що я повинен включати #myDivв селектор, тому що я виконую запит на myDivелементі (тому …

6
Чи є CSS, що не дорівнює селектору?
Чи є щось подібне! = (Не рівне) у CSS? наприклад, у мене є такий код: input { ... ... } але для деяких входів мені це потрібно анулювати. Я хотів би зробити це, додавши клас "скидання" до вхідного тегу, наприклад <input class="reset" ... /> а потім просто пропустити цей тег …
116 html  css  css-selectors 

Використовуючи наш веб-сайт, ви визнаєте, що прочитали та зрозуміли наші Політику щодо файлів cookie та Політику конфіденційності.
Licensed under cc by-sa 3.0 with attribution required.